    I use a booking form on my site. My email or phone # isnt listed on the site unless the viewer is using the mobile version.

    I took the email address off because the racist hatemail and constant requests to see people for free. Vetting my own calls and emails, the time wasters and harassers took too much time out of the day. Paring it down to a form became necessary after starting my new job.

    However, its probably better to have it there just in case the form stops working. Some clients feel the forms aren't secure and prefer to email you directly. Some don't want to email at all and rather talk on the phone. It boils down to what you have time for.

    I have a link to my screening form on my site, but then I also have a little blurb like "alternatively if you'd feel more comfortable contacting me through my secure email address, you can reach me at *email address*. I've found guys mostly use the email maybe 70% of the time, screening form 30%. With the screening form only, I think some guys were getting intimidated by all the info I'd ask for, whereas I found out that if they emailed me a few bits of info, I could usually find out the rest of my own without intimidating them. For example, they'd be hesitant to give their work info, yet when I googled their name and email address, it came up anyway without me having to ask for it.

    Luckily I haven't had too many timewasters, and no hatemail (that's horrible that people would even do that!!) One tip I heard early on that I've stuck to and I think has worked well, is don't put your email address on your site as a text. other sites that "crawl" your website can pick it up and before you know it, you're getting spam mail out the wazoo. I have my email address as an image file, which makes it harder for spam places to pick it up.
